Formulate the following problem as a Dynamic Programming problem and solve it using a multi-

stage optimization strategy. (Note: No credits will be given for solving it using any other means)new

A company needs to have a working machine during neach of the next six years. Currently it has a new machine. At the beginnig nf each year, the company may keep the machine or sell it and buy a new one, but a machine cannot be kept for more than three years. A ne machine costs $5000. The revenues earned by a machine, the cost of maintaining it, and the salvage value that can be obtained by selling at the end of a year depend on the age of the machine (given in the Table below). Use dynamic programming to maxime the net profit earned during next six years.

Age of machine at beginning of year 0 year 1 year 2 years Revenues ($) 4,500 3000 1500 Operating costs ($) 500 700 1100 Salvage value at end of year ($) 3000 1800 500
